Built on Valkey/Redis Streams with a Rust NAPI core. Completes and fetches the next job in a single server-side function call (1 RTT per job), hash-tags every key for zero-config clustering, and ships AI-native primitives for cost tracking, token streaming, human-in-the-loop suspend/resume, model failover, TPM rate limiting, budget caps, rolling usage summaries, and vector search. General Usage AI Usage When to use glide-mq - Background jobs and task processing - email, image processing, data pipelines, webhooks, any async work. - Scheduled and recurring work - cron jobs, interval tasks, bounded schedulers. - Distributed workflows - parent-child trees, DAGs, fan-in/fan-out, step jobs, dynamic children. - High-throughput queues over real networks - 1 RTT per job via Valkey Server Functions, up to 38% faster than alternatives. - LLM pipelines and model orchestration - cost tracking, token streaming, model failover, budget caps without external middleware. - Valkey/Redis clusters - hash-tagged keys out of the box with zero configuration.
